About Tarik T. Binnekade

Tarik T. Binnekade is a scholar working on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ine, Physical Therapy, Sports Therapy and Rehabilitation and Periodontics, having authored 12 papers that have together received 841 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Pain Management and Opioid Use (5 papers), Balance, Gait, and Falls Prevention (3 papers) and Musculoskeletal pain and rehabilitation (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Physical Therapy, Sports Therapy and Rehabilitation (188 citations), Periodontics (191 citations) and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(127 citations). Tarik T. Binnekade has collaborated with scholars based in Netherlands, Australia and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Laura Eggermont, Pat Schofield, Brendon Stubbs, Erik Scherder, Cees M.P.M. Hertogh, Frank Lobbezoo, Roberto S.G.M. Perez, Sandhiran Patchay, Amir A. Sepehry and Suzanne Delwel. Their work appears in journals such as Archives of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ation, Ageing Research Reviews and Dementia and Geriatric Cognitive Disorders.
